Product Description:
The AO-02 oxygen sensor is designed for use in various instruments related to oxygen testing, such as vehicle exhaust gas detection instruments, waste gas environmental protection detection instruments, and oxygen index testing instruments, etc. This application is limited to system monitoring only. The data provided in this document was measured at 20°C, 50% RH and 1013 mBar and is valid for 3 months from the date of sensor manufacturing. Please strictly follow the instructions for operating the oxygen analyzer and replacing the oxygen sensor.
Installation and Usage:
1. Installation requirements:
When installing the sensor, it can only be tightened by hand and ensure an airtight seal. Do not use wrenches or similar mechanical auxiliary tools, as excessive force may damage the sensor thread.
2. Storage and Use:
The AO-02 design is suitable for operation in various environments and harsh conditions, but it is still necessary to avoid exposure to high concentrations of solvent vapors during storage, installation and operation.
When using sensors with printed circuit boards (PCBS), a degreaser should be applied before installing the sensors. Do not stick it directly on or near the shell, as the solvent may cause the plastic to crack.
3. Cleaning:
In case of contamination, the sensor can be cleaned with distilled water and allowed to dry naturally. This sensor is not suitable for steam sterilization Or exposure to chemicals such as ethylene oxide or hydrogen peroxide.
